What You’ll Do Lead the daily culinary operation for all banquet, catering, wedding, conference, meeting, and special-event functions. Direct, coach, schedule, and develop a banquet culinary team of approximately 40 employees, including sous chefs, supervisors, cooks, and culinary support positions. Partner directly with the Executive Chef to execute the resort’s culinary vision, banquet standards, financial goals, and strategic priorities. Oversee large-scale production and simultaneous event execution while maintaining exceptional food quality, presentation, consistency, and timeliness. Review banquet event orders, group resumes, diagrams, menus, timelines, and guest counts to ensure all culinary requirements are understood and properly planned. Lead daily banquet event order meetings, culinary production meetings, and pre-shift briefings to communicate priorities, assignments, changes, and service expectations. Develop comprehensive production plans, prep lists, station assignments, and execution timelines for upcoming events. Coordinate culinary production across multiple kitchens, event spaces, outdoor venues, and off-site or specialty locations as required. Ensure banquet functions are set, plated, replenished, and served according to established timelines and presentation standards. Collaborate closely with Banquets, Events, Conference Services, Stewarding, Purchasing, Receiving, and other operational departments to ensure seamless event execution. Maintain a visible presence during event preparation and service, responding quickly to changes, guest requests, and operational challenges. Partner with the Executive Chef on banquet menu development, seasonal offerings, customized menus, tastings, VIP events, and large-scale culinary activations. Lead wedding and event tastings while ensuring menu selections can be executed successfully at the contracted guest count. Maintain standardized recipes, plating guides, photographs, production procedures, and portion-control standards. Monitor food quality, seasoning, cooking temperatures, portion sizes, presentation, and service readiness throughout production and execution. Manage food cost through accurate forecasting, purchasing, ordering, production planning, portion control, inventory management, and waste reduction. Manage culinary labor through effective scheduling, productivity planning, overtime control, cross-utilization, and staffing adjustments based on business volume. Ensure accurate ordering, receiving, labeling, storage, rotation, and organization of all culinary products using FIFO and food safety best practices. Establish and maintain appropriate inventory and par levels based on forecasted event volume and operational needs. Review event guarantees and production quantities to minimize waste while ensuring sufficient product is available for successful execution. Assist with annual budgeting, forecasting, expense management, capital planning, and financial performance reviews. Qualifications Minimum of five years of progressive culinary leadership experience in a high-volume hotel, resort, convention center, catering company, or large banquet operation. Previous experience leading a large culinary team, preferably 30 or more employees. Demonstrated experience executing multiple simultaneous events, including weddings, conferences, plated dinners, buffets, receptions, and large-scale functions. Strong knowledge of banquet production, large-volume cooking, event timelines, kitchen logistics, and plated-meal execution. Proven ability to lead high-volume culinary operations while maintaining exceptional quality, consistency, presentation, and service timing. Experience managing labor, scheduling, food costs, purchasing, inventory, waste, and departmental budgets. Strong understanding of menu development, recipe costing, production planning, portion control, and profitability. Excellent leadership, organizational, communication, and problem-solving skills. Ability to prioritize multiple events and changing demands while remaining calm and decisive under pressure. Strong interpersonal skills and the ability to build effective partnerships across culinary, banquet, event, and resort leadership teams. Experience recruiting, coaching, developing, and managing the performance of culinary employees and leaders. Advanced knowledge of food safety, sanitation, workplace safety, allergens, and HACCP principles. Proficiency with Microsoft Office, scheduling systems, purchasing platforms, event management systems, and culinary costing tools preferred. Culinary degree or formal culinary education preferred but not required. California Food Handler Card and ServSafe Manager Certification, or the ability to obtain required certifications within the designated timeframe. Must be available to work a flexible schedule, including early mornings, evenings, weekends, holidays, and extended hours based on event demands. Physical Requirements This position requires standing and walking for extended periods, lifting up to 50 pounds, frequent bending, reaching, pushing, pulling, and repetitive movements while working throughout a large commercial culinary operation. The Banquet Chef regularly works around hot cooking equipment, open flames, ovens, refrigerated storage areas, sharp tools, heavy equipment, loading areas, outdoor event spaces, and cleaning chemicals. The position may require moving between multiple kitchens and event venues throughout the resort while maintaining strict safety standards and wearing required personal protective equipment.
